CertainMultinational supervisor or executiveYou must have been employed outside the United States for at least 1 year in the 3 years preceding the application or the most recent legal nonimmigrant admission if you are already working for the U.S
The United state petitioner should have been doing business for at least 1 year, have a qualifying relationship to the entity you worked for outside the U.S., and plan to utilize you in a supervisory or executive ability. Your requesting employer should be a United state company and mean to use you in a supervisory or executive capability.

The L1 Visa is a non-immigrant visa planned to facilitate the short-term transfer of foreign workers to US offices of the company they work for. L1 Visas are available to workers of international business that have branches both abroad and in the US.The L1 Visa likewise allows foreign firms that do not yet have a workplace in the anchor US to send an executive or a manager to the US so that they can develop one.
To be qualified for the visa, workers have to have been helping the firm for a minimum of one continuous year within the 3 years preceding their planned admission to the US (L1 Visa For Indian Nationals).The visa enables staff members ahead to the US for a certain amount of time and help the very same employer as in their home country yet in a United States office
Furthermore, the L1 Visa is only available to individuals who hold exec or managerial duties within their companies. Executive ability indicates that an employee is entitled to choose without much supervision. Supervisory ability, on the various other hand, indicates that a staff member can regulate the work of other workers and manage some aspects of running the business or its division.
